How much does it cost to rent an apartment in WeHo?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
WeHo Studio Apartments | $2,089 | $1,739 | $2,783 |
WeHo 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,973 | $1,795 | $10,000+ |
WeHo 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,466 | $2,595 | $10,000+ |
WeHo 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,484 | $3,995 | $9,000 |
